ERP data is some of the most asked-for data in the warehouse and some of the hardest to get: the record types are many, the APIs are strict, and extract jobs are brittle. Whether SAP S/4HANA carries financials, operations, workforce data, or all three, the analysis belongs in Snowflake next to everything else the company measures.
Stacksync syncs Purchase Orders, Products / Materials, Billing Documents (Invoices), Deliveries from SAP S/4HANA into tables in Snowflake continuously, managing API limits and schema drift along the way. The connection is bi-directional, so values computed in Snowflake can be written back to fields in SAP S/4HANA where that is useful.
Combine SAP S/4HANA's records with data synced from other systems in Snowflake for consolidated views no single system can produce.
Classifications or reference values computed in Snowflake sync back onto the corresponding records in SAP S/4HANA.
Financial records land in Snowflake as they change, so period-end reporting queries current numbers rather than last night's extract.

Snowflake: Compute runs on virtual warehouses that are billed and scaled separately from storage, so sync workloads can be isolated on their own warehouse. SAP S/4HANA: The Business Partner model consolidates what older SAP systems split into separate customer and vendor masters. Change detection on SAP S/4HANA: Polling on change timestamps exposed by the OData services; business events can be emitted through SAP's event infrastructure on cloud editions. On Snowflake: Not explicitly stated; the setup script grants "create stream" on synced schemas (Snowflake streams), but the docs do not name the change-capture mechanism. Each detected change propagates to the other side in milliseconds, with field-level conflict resolution and an inspectable event log.
